Scottish mason's stone carving & conservation workshop

May 12-13, 2010
Scottish mason's stone carving & conservation workshop

Two award winning mason’s (Kenny McCaffrey and Malcolm Hutcheon) from Historic Scotland will be in NYC presenting a two-day training workshop for the students of Abyssinian Development Corp’s (ADC) YouthBuild masonry preservation program.   

Historic Scotland is the executive agency of the Scottish Government charged with safeguarding the nation’s historic environment and promoting its understanding and enjoyment on behalf of Scottish Ministers.  http://www.historic-scotland.gov.uk/index.htm   

Kenny and Malcolm will be demonstrating the stone carving skills and advanced masonry conservation practices they perform on Scottish castles, monuments, landmarks and residences.

Students will be practicing these stone carving and preservation techniques at two different sites.  Guests are welcome to visit and experience the training-in-process.  

Wednesday, May,12th The Workshop will take place at: The Cathedral of Saint John the Divine, north parking lot on West 113th Street, NYC.    

Thursday, May, 13th The Workshop will take place at: The West 127th Street park/ play lot, east of Lenox Avenue, NYC.
